"Truck Accident Spills 100,000 Live Salmon into Oregon Creek"

A tanker truck carrying over 100,000 live salmon from Oregon's Lookingglass Hatchery overturned, spilling most of the fish into a nearby creek, with the majority surviving and swimming away. Cleanup efforts were aided by local hatchery members, Nez Perce tribe members, and the Union County Sheriff's Office. While about 25,000 smolts did not survive, approximately 77,000 made it into Lookingglass Creek. The spill constituted 20 percent of the total fish count state hatcheries planned to release into the Imnaha River this year, impacting the hatchery's ability to supplement the threatened wild salmon population.

Truck Accident Forces Extended Closure of I-95 Northbound in Philadelphia

A truck hitting an overhead Conrail bridge in Philadelphia's Port Richmond section has led to the closure of a portion of Interstate 95 northbound for several days, causing significant traffic disruptions and impacting rail service. Drivers are advised to avoid the closure areas and expect significant backups on I-95, with detours in place for affected ramps. Additionally, Atlantic City Rail Line service has been suspended between Philadelphia's 30th Street Station and Cherry Hill, New Jersey.
